متن کاملThe ECM-Cell Interaction of Cartilage Extracellular Matrix on Chondrocytes
Cartilage extracellular matrix (ECM) is composed primarily of the network type II collagen (COLII) and an interlocking mesh of fibrous proteins and proteoglycans (PGs), hyaluronic acid (HA), and chondroitin sulfate (CS).
